How to Grow Clover in Guadalajara
Guadalajara, MX is in USDA Hardiness Zone 9 with a Humid subtropical (dry winter) climate (Köppen Cwa). With winter lows of 8°C and summer highs of 31°C, the growing season spans approximately 365 frost-free days. Clover is one of the easiest plants to grow in this climate.
Clover thrives in temperatures between 10°C and 22°C, requiring full sun and moderate watering. In Guadalajara, the best months to plant Clover are November, December, January, February. Since Clover can tolerate frost, you have flexibility to plant earlier in the season or extend into cooler months. Expect to harvest in approximately 60-90 days after planting.
With 941mm of annual rainfall, Guadalajara provides moderate natural moisture. This should be adequate for Clover's water needs.
